Output ec871e73fba3e7c615a5ff05a0f5808c05e7be93e43d77c988bd435fdca06b4f:3

value
20806351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1995e0d66054f4401446a15e31d663371266527b OP_EQUAL
address
342JN4gkSAMouHrVjtLocpP4wRYbvYGnzQ
transaction
ec871e73fba3e7c615a5ff05a0f5808c05e7be93e43d77c988bd435fdca06b4f
confirmations
362089
spent
true